What Do Data Mining Analysts Do?
- Identify, collect, analyze, and present trends, visualizations, and summaries of data.
- Create, update, and maintain data dictionaries, including data integrity problems.
- Collaborate with business owners to define metrics and performance indicators and produce analyses.
- Create algorithms and predictive models using statistical techniques.
- Produce presentations and reports for multiple audiences.

How can Data Mining Analysts increase their salary?
Increasing your pay as a Data Mining Analyst is possible in different ways. Change of employer: Consider a career move to a new employer that is willing to pay higher for your skills. Level of Education: Gaining advanced degrees may allow this role to increase their income potential and qualify for promotions. Managing Experience: If you are a Data Mining Analyst that oversees more junior Data Mining Analysts, this experience can increase the likelihood to earn more.
